Описание:Let X be a smooth, connected complex projective curve of genus at least 2. A Higgs coherent system is defined as an augmented bundle (E, V), where E is a holomorphic vector bundle over X, and V is a linear subspace of the space of Higgs fields of E. The purpose of this paper is twofold. First, we introduce the moduli problem of Higgs coherent systems over X. Second, we construct the fine moduli space for Higgs coherent systems with stable underlying vector bundles. The construction is achieved by establishing the representability of the associated moduli functor by a projective scheme together with a universal family.
